What is Biotechnology?

Biotechnology refers to the use of living organisms or biological systems to develop products or processes that improve human life and the environment. The field encompasses diverse areas, including genetically modified organisms, genetic testing, pharmaceutical development, and biofuels. As a multidisciplinary science, biotechnology integrates biological sciences such as microbiology and genetics with technology and engineering principles to create innovative solutions.

Typically, biotechnology programs emphasize a combination of theoretical knowledge and practical laboratory skills. Through a rigorous curriculum, students gain insights into the intricate workings of biological systems and their applications in real-world scenarios.

What Do You Study in Biotechnology?

Students enrolled in biotechnology programs undertake a comprehensive curriculum designed to build essential scientific competencies. The curriculum typically includes core subjects, elective courses, and hands-on laboratory experiences.

Core Subjects

  • Biochemistry: Understanding the chemical processes and substances essential for life, including metabolism and enzyme function.
  • Genetics: Study of heredity, genetic variation, and techniques for genetic manipulation and testing.
  • Cell Biology: Examination of cellular structure and function, alongside tissue engineering and cell culture methods.
  • Microbiology: Exploration of microorganisms and their applications in health, industry, and environmental conservation.
  • Molecular Biology: Dive into molecular genetics, gene expression, and biotechnology techniques like cloning and sequencing.

Elective Courses

Students often have the opportunity to tailor their studies by choosing elective courses that may include areas such as:

  • Pharmaceutical Biotechnology
  • Agricultural Biotechnology
  • Environmental Biotechnology
  • Bioinformatics
  • Industrial Biotechnology

Labs, Workshops, and Internships

Hands-on experience is an essential part of biotechnology education. Students participate in a variety of practical training sessions that enhance their laboratory skills. These may include:

  • DNA/RNA/Protein Extraction and Purification: Learning to isolate and purify nucleic acids and proteins for research and development.
  • Cell Culture Techniques: Establishing and maintaining cultures of mammalian, plant, or bacterial cells for experimentation.
  • Polymerase Chain Reaction (PCR): Mastering various PCR techniques, including real-time and quantitative PCR for genetic analysis.
  • Enzyme Activity Assays and ELISA Techniques: Performing assays to detect and quantify proteins using enzyme-linked immunosorbent assays.
  • Research Projects and Internships: Collaborations with local biotech companies and research institutions allow students to gain real-world experience.

Careers After Biotechnology

Graduates from biotechnology programs enjoy various career opportunities across multiple sectors. Depending on their specialization and interests, they may pursue roles in industries such as agriculture, pharmaceuticals, environmental sciences, or health care. Here are some potential career pathways:

  • Biotechnology Technician: Involved in laboratory operations like testing, sampling, and conducting experiments.
  • Laboratory Technologist: Specializing in specific areas such as clinical diagnostics or biochemical analysis.
  • Quality Control Analyst: Ensuring the safety and efficacy of biomedical products by conducting rigorous testing and quality assessments.
  • Research Scientist: Engaging in scientific exploration and experiments to develop new products or technologies.
  • Clinical Research Coordinator: Managing clinical trials and research projects for new therapies in healthcare.

Salary Ranges

The average salary for biotechnology professionals can vary based on location, experience, and specific roles. Here are some estimated salary ranges:

  • Biotechnology Technician: USD 40,000 – 65,000 (approximately EUR 34,000 – 55,000)
  • Laboratory Technologist: USD 50,000 – 80,000 (approximately EUR 42,000 – 67,000)
  • Quality Control Analyst: USD 45,000 – 75,000 (approximately EUR 38,000 – 63,000)
  • Research Scientist: USD 60,000 – 100,000 (approximately EUR 51,000 – 84,000)
  • Clinical Research Coordinator: USD 55,000 – 90,000 (approximately EUR 46,000 – 75,000)

Is Biotechnology Hard to Study?

Pursuing a degree in biotechnology can be challenging due to the interdisciplinary nature of the subject and the in-depth scientific knowledge required. Students often face the following challenges:

  • Complex Subject Matter: Mastery of various scientific principles—chemistry, biology, and physics—is vital.
  • Laboratory Skills: Proficiency in advanced laboratory techniques requires substantial practice and precision.
  • Research and Analytical Skills: Students must effectively analyze data and understand experimental design to conduct research successfully.
  • Time Management: Balancing coursework, lab work, and possibly internships can be demanding.

Required Skills for Success

To thrive in a biotechnology program, students should possess the following skills:

  • Strong analytical and problem-solving skills
  • Attention to detail and precision in laboratory settings
  • Effective communication abilities for teamwork and presentations
  • Adaptability and eagerness to learn emerging scientific concepts

Preparation Tips

Those considering a biotechnology program should:

  • Strengthen foundational knowledge in biology and chemistry during high school.
  • Engage in science-related extracurricular activities or internships for early exposure.
  • Develop laboratory skills through hands-on experiences or community college courses.
  • Stay updated with current trends and technologies in biotechnology through literature and online courses.

Top Certifications After Biotechnology Graduation

Although a degree in biotechnology provides essential qualifications, obtaining additional certifications can enhance employment prospects and professional standing. Important certifications or licenses may include:

  • Certified Biotechnician (CBT): This certification validates expertise in biotechnology-related competencies.
  • Clinical Research Certification (CCRC or CCRA): Useful for those pursuing careers in clinical research.
  • Laboratory Animal Technician (LAT): Relevant for careers involving animal research and testing.
  • Six Sigma Certification: Beneficial for those looking to improve quality and efficiency in laboratory settings.
